| ||Co*ni"um |
| [NL., fr.
Gr. (?) hemlock.] |
A genus
of biennial, poisonous, white-flowered, umbelliferous plants,
bearing ribbed fruit ("seeds") and decompound leaves.
The common hemlock
(Conium maculatum, poison hemlock, spotted hemlock, poison
parsley), a roadside weed of Europe, Asia, and America,
cultivated in the United States for medicinal purpose. It is an
active poison. The leaves and fruit are used in
medicine.
